Bing Maps Redesign Introduced

Microsoft has announced a new step in the evolution of its mapping, search and location platform, involving a Bing Maps redesign, changes to existing features as well as the release of a new AJAX control.

Users already familiar with Bing Maps will notice modifications related to the left hand side panel. According to the Redmond company, the layout was changed in order to simplify navigation for end users.

“One thing we changed is the left-side rail for Bing.com/Maps, giving you a direct on-ramp to what you want to do: get driving, walking, or transit directions; view live traffic and traffic cameras; view local restaurants and businesses; and explore Map Apps,” revealed Brian Hendricks, Bing Maps Product Manager.

The overhauled left-side rail now makes it extremely simple for users to get directions, but also access traffic information, locate businesses and even explore the map applications available.

Hendricks noted that additional work was put into unifying the AJAX and Silverlight. Essentially, the software giant has transformed StreetSide into a Map App.

Still, both Map Apps and StreetSide continue to require Silverlight to be installed on the user’s computer in order to work.

“To access Map Apps, click either the “explore map apps” link or the Map Apps button in the lower-left of the screen. Use the search box or change the sort to find the map app you’re looking for,” Hendricks explained.

At the same time, Microsoft offers improved browsing performance, updated navigation controls, enhanced Bird’s eye and optimizations for mobile devices with the latest release of the Bing Maps AJAX control, namely version 7.

“V7 is fast, is great for mobile web and introduces new and differentiated ways for you to connect with your customers. To learn more about all of the features and enhancements in V7, take a look at the Bing AJAX map control v7 SDK,” added Floyd Mendoza, Bing Maps Product Manager Enterprise Mapping.
